Downstage Theatre Downstage: Get Curious New Zealand has hundreds of artists creating work for the stage right here, right now. They are our indie artists.

We invest our time, expertise and infrastructure in the future of New Zealand theatre by staging the work indie artists need to make and indie audiences need to see. Independent in thought, independent in vision – often independent of regular funding and infrastructure. For years they worked in a wilderness, creating projects on a shoestring, winning awards but barely making rent money. Most indie

companies collapsed after a few projects, members scattering to work as hired guns for arts institutions or, worse, leaving the industry altogether. They inspired us to change our whole way of working…
We looked to the fresh creativity of the indie sector and saw they had stories they needed to tell. Stories inspired by life here and now. Stories meant for the people of here and now. Stories told in ways we’d never seen before. Stories that weren’t being heard. Since 2009 we’ve worked to change that. We start by looking for the stand outs…

The work that blows us away and the artists we can instantly believe in. Putting the resources of our company behind their vision we build a programme designed to connect them with a wider audience – and make them a guaranteed income. Plus we enable mid-career artists to present original work without the financial risk of profit-share. This means artists with families can know they’ll put food on the table while delivering work from the prime of their creative careers. Right now we’re staging some of the most exciting work in the country – art that connects with people in a new and more direct way. Plus we’re working for a healthier cultural future. We believe strong artistic voices contribute to the health of our society by inspiring imaginative risk-taking, creative problem solving and independent thinking. The Board of Downstage Theatre today announced its decision to close the company. The theatre closure will take place immediately following the season of Live at Six, which is currently showing.

“In recent years the theatre has pursued a new model – based on partnerships with artistic companies, taking risks on new works, and creating a supportive environment for artists.
